Students have to collect their TN SSLC original certificate from their schools. They will be notified by the schools after the release of the results. Usually students will receive the Tamil Nadu SSLC mark list within 2 weeks after the results.

In case the details mentioned in your Tamil Nadu Class 10 result 2024 are incorrect, you must contact the school officials and get them rectified. It is important to have correct details in your result, marksheet and other certificates as these are important documents and will be required at the time of admission for higher education. Colleges/universities and other institutes will not allow admission in case of incorrect details.
